The paragraph in the original article that is being left out is the one that the coaches talk about how if they are not going to play their base defense a whole lot, they need to find a way to get AJ on the field more.

Look how Kampman looked lost the first few weeks, last week they put him in a scheme that was right for him and he looked like his old self.

I expect this week, early anyway that Hawk will be on the field quite a bit, but if The Packers jump out to a big lead and The Browns are forced to throw the ball, hopefully the coaches have figured out a way to get AJ in there.

I love the one guys response, grouping Hawk with the likes of Harrell, Lee and others. AJ HAWK IS NOT A BUST,The Packers just need to figure out how to utilize his talents in the 3-4

Those of you who have been clamoring for Bishop, well this might be the week he gets his chance.

With the shape The Browns are in, it will probably be like playing against 2nd and 3rd stringers in pre-season.
